summ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orEric Anholt <eric@anholt.net>2014-09-29 15:17:40 -0700
committerEric Anholt <eric@anholt.net>2015-06-04 14:15:20 -0700
commit98a77991dd8791f1c2f194306a6199cbe807011d (patch)
tree80ef58b81f69f39686961337ab2c21a8df2c5269
parentfe321deeab8be919a785b676694909d339c0046b (diff)
downloadlinux-98a77991dd8791f1c2f194306a6199cbe807011d.tar.gz
drm/vc4: Fix validation of multi-level raster textures.
By not minifying our size, we'd reject valid texture configurations. Signed-off-by: Eric Anholt <eric@anholt.net>
-rw-r--r--drivers/gpu/drm/vc4/vc4_validate.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/gpu/drm/vc4/vc4_validate.c b/drivers/gpu/drm/vc4/vc4_validate.c
index aa8f09dbe4dc..9729a30d7798 100644
--- a/drivers/gpu/drm/vc4/vc4_validate.c
+++ b/drivers/gpu/drm/vc4/vc4_validate.c
@@ -847,7 +847,7 @@ reloc_tex(struct exec_info *exec,
break;
default:
aligned_width = roundup(level_width, 16 / cpp);
- aligned_height = height;
+ aligned_height = level_height;
break;
}